Port Orchard Players Win New Silverados

August 1st, 2013   ·   Add Your Comment Now...

Two lottery enthusiasts from Port Orchard have won new Silverado trucks from the Washington Lottery’s Trucks and Bucks game.

Kelly Gast, a veterinary technician who has only ever won $5 to $20 on occasional lotto and scratch ticket purchases, won in the first drawing.  She was at home when the Washington Lottery’s representative called to inform her of the win.  She informed her husband right away, and went on to pick an ice silver 2014 Chevy Silverado with a black leather interior.

She plans to take the new truck on a trip before school starts.

Paul Zunich, the winner in the second drawing is a certified lottery enthusiast who also plays Powerball, Mega Millionsand Match 4  regularly.  And since he entered in the second drawing of the Trucks and Bucks game, Paul had bought tickets in packets of 50.

His persistence paid off when he was informed he was the second winner of a truck.  He later chose a metallic blue topaz 2014 Chevy Silverado, which he plans to show off at the bar where he usually scratches off tickets.
